Pastor's Perspective
In the first book of the Bible – in its very first chapters
– we find the story of creation. On the seventh day,
“The Sabbath”, God rested from all He had made and saw that
it was very good. I like to imagine the Father, Son and Holy
Spirit resting in rocking chairs on the front porch of Heaven looking
out over all creation and just enjoying it all!
In the book of Sirach (39:14-16,33,35) we read:
Bless the Lord for all He has done!
Proclaim the greatness of his name,
Loudly sing his praises.
Sing out with joy as you proclaim:
The works of God are all of them good.
Every need when it comes he fills.
So now with full joy of heart proclaim
And bless the name of the Holy One.
As we savor these Summer days let the things of earth refresh us and
increase our awareness of the beauty of all creation around us.
